Skip to main content

Listing Widgets


Characteristic Select tsm-characteristics-lov

Selection of a characteristic from a dropdown list.

Widget Or Layout: widget

Value:

{
  "type": "string",
  "title": "Select Characteristic",
  "widget": {
    "type": "tsm-characteristics-lov"
  }
}

Inputs

Default value

Key: default

Name: Default value

Filters

Key: defaultFilters

Name: Filters

Keyboard on mobile

Key: keyboardOnMobile

Name: Keyboard on mobile

Show clear

Key: showClear

Name: Show clear

Show none text

Key: showNoneText

Name: Show none text

Select first value

Key: selectFirstValue

Name: Select first value

Selection using a listing (one or more values)

Key: multiselect

Name: Selection using a listing (one or more values)

Value

Key: selectProperty

Name: Value

Display

Key: displayField

Name: Display

Description: It is possible to add multiple values using autocomplete or with source code ["key", "name"]


Listing Profile Select dtl-listing-profile-lov

Selection of a listing profile from a dropdown list.

Widget Or Layout: widget

Value:

{
  "type": "object",
  "title": "Select a Listing Profile",
  "widget": {
    "type": "dtl-listing-profile-lov"
  }
}

Inputs

Keyboard on mobile

Key: keyboardOnMobile

Name: Keyboard on mobile

Show clear

Key: showClear

Name: Show clear

Show none text

Key: showNoneText

Name: Show none text

Entity type

Key: entityType

Name: Entity type

Select first value

Key: selectFirstValue

Name: Select first value

Selection using a listing (one or more values)

Key: multiselect

Name: Selection using a listing (one or more values)

Value

Key: selectProperty

Name: Value

Default value

Key: default

Name: Default value

Filters

Key: defaultFilters

Name: Filters


Listing Column Select dtl-listing-column-field-lov

Selection of a listing column from a dropdown list.

Widget Or Layout: widget

Value:

{
  "type": "object",
  "title": "Select a Listing Column",
  "widget": {
    "type": "dtl-listing-column-field-lov"
  }
}

Inputs

Show clear

Key: showClear

Name: Show clear

Show none text

Key: showNoneText

Name: Show none text

Value

Key: selectProperty

Name: Value

Listing

Key: listingCode

Name: Listing

Wrap value in row['value']

Key: addRowWrap

Name: Wrap value in row['value']

Default value

Key: default

Name: Default value


Form Select tsm-config-form-lov

Selection of a form from a dropdown list.

Widget Or Layout: widget

Value:

{
  "type": "object",
  "title": "Select a Form",
  "widget": {
    "type": "tsm-config-form-lov"
  }
}

Inputs

Value

Key: selectProperty

Name: Value

Default value

Key: default

Name: Default value


Entity Type Select tsm-entity-type-lov

Selection of an entity type from a dropdown list.

Widget Or Layout: widget

Value:

{
  "title": "Select an Entity Type",
  "widget": {
    "type": "tsm-entity-type-lov"
  },
  "config": {
    "selectProperty": "code"
  },
  "type": "string"
}

Inputs

Default value

Key: default

Name: Default value

Filters

Key: defaultFilters

Name: Filters

Keyboard on mobile

Key: keyboardOnMobile

Name: Keyboard on mobile

Show clear

Key: showClear

Name: Show clear

Show none text

Key: showNoneText

Name: Show none text

Select first value

Key: selectFirstValue

Name: Select first value

Selection using a listing (one or more values)

Key: multiselect

Name: Selection using a listing (one or more values)

Value

Key: selectProperty

Name: Value

Display

Key: displayField

Name: Display

Description: It is possible to add multiple values using autocomplete or with source code ["key", "name"]


Listing Type Select dtl-listing-type-lov

Selection of a listing type from a dropdown list.

Widget Or Layout: widget

Value:

{
  "type": "object",
  "title": "Select a Listing Type",
  "widget": {
    "type": "dtl-listing-type-lov"
  }
}

Inputs

Entity type

Key: entityType

Name: Entity type

Default value

Key: default

Name: Default value

Filters

Key: defaultFilters

Name: Filters

Keyboard on mobile

Key: keyboardOnMobile

Name: Keyboard on mobile

Show clear

Key: showClear

Name: Show clear

Show none text

Key: showNoneText

Name: Show none text

Select first value

Key: selectFirstValue

Name: Select first value

Selection using a listing (one or more values)

Key: multiselect

Name: Selection using a listing (one or more values)

Value

Key: selectProperty

Name: Value

Display

Key: displayField

Name: Display

Description: It is possible to add multiple values using autocomplete or with source code ["key", "name"]


Configuration Profile Select Panel tsm-entity-specifications-base-info

Selection of a configuration profile on the panel.

Widget Or Layout: layout

Value:

{
  "type": "layout",
  "title": "Select a Configuration Profile ",
  "widget": {
    "type": "tsm-entity-specifications-base-info"
  }
}

Inputs

Default value

Key: default

Name: Default value

Specs id

Key: specsId

Name: Specs id

Specs code

Key: specsCode

Name: Specs code

Permissions

Key: permissions

Name: Permissions

Show clear

Key: showClearEntitySpecification

Name: Show clear

Entity type

Key: entityType

Name: Entity type

Ngrx action

Key: ngrxAction

Name: Ngrx action

Description: Specify the ngrx action that will be dispatched after the form is submitted.

Extender object

Key: ngrxActionData

Name: Extender object

Description: Specify the data that will be dispatched with the ngrx action.

Help

Key: helpMessage

Name: Help

Description: Help

Filters

Key: defaultFilters

Name: Filters


Data view component dtl-data-view-widget

Data view component

Widget Or Layout: layout

Value:

{
  "type": "layout",
  "title": "Data view component",
  "widget": {
    "type": "dtl-data-view-widget"
  }
}

Inputs

Hide

Key: hidden

Name: Hide

Title

Key: label

Name: Title

Listing

Key: listingTypeCode

Name: Listing